A new education establishment is soon to open in the Democratic Republic of Congo. The Congolese British Grammar School is seeking partnership and support from Derby schools.
The school aims to deliver the following:

  • Partnership with UK based schools for mentoring and support to achieve expected level of education for English language and curriculum.
  • High standards British education in francophone speaking country.
  • Twinning scheme for capacity building and coaching of staff in English language.
  • Opportunity for school trip to DR Congo in Kolwezi town- known for its large scale ( industry) mining of copper and cobalt use for electric vehicles – supply chain for Telsa and BMW. Also opportunity to explore the tourism sites, Safari in Upemba Park in Lualaba Province and the source of Congo River, history of mining town of Kolwezi copper and cobalt.
  • Visit of modern mines of high tech for production copper cathode and cobalt oxide – Tenke Fungurume and Kamoa in Kolwezi.
